Job Title Salaried General Practitioner (GP) Reports To Practice Partners / Practice Manager Location The Health Centre, Woodland Avenue, Goole DN14 6RU And our branch site: The Surgery, Alfreds Place Swinefleet Road Goole DN14 5RL Job Summary The Salaried GP provides high-quality primary medical care to registered patients within the practice. The role involves diagnosing and managing acute and chronic illnesses, promoting health and wellbeing, and working collaboratively with the wider multidisciplinary team to deliver patient-centred care. Key Responsibilities Clinical Duties Provide comprehensive general medical services to patients registered with the practice. Assess, diagnose, treat, and manage a wide range of acute and chronic medical conditions. Conduct face-to-face, telephone, and online consultations. Prescribe medications in accordance with NHS and practice guidelines. Refer patients to secondary care services when appropriate. Manage test results, clinical correspondence, and follow-up care. Maintain accurate and contemporaneous electronic patient records. Patient Care Deliver preventative care and health promotion. Support the management of long-term conditions such as diabetes, asthma, and hypertension. Provide safeguarding support for vulnerable adults and children where necessary. Participate in home visits when required. Teamwork and Collaboration Work collaboratively with our multidisciplinary team. Contribute to clinical meetings and practice discussions. Support training and supervision of medical students or GP trainees, where applicable. Governance and Quality Adhere to NHS, GMC, and CQC regulations and standards. Participate in clinical audit, quality improvement, and significant event reviews. Maintain professional registration and revalidation requirements. Engage in continuing professional development (CPD). Working Hours Typically 6 sessions per week (a session usually equals approximately 4 hours 10 minutes). Participation in duty doctor rota may be required. No responsibility for practice management decisions unless agreed.
